It is weird because they said you can't generate invoke cards, invoke lovers and galakrond by any means (invoking, through discovering, adding random cards), except by lazul, mind vision, thoughtsteal, ...
They changed it in a patch recently - you can now generate Invoke cards in decks that run Galakrond.
Oh, okay. I think that is great. Just tell me this if you know. Are they going to change this again so that you can't generate these cards or are they going to allow us to generate cards forever?
The invoke cards rotate with the Galakronds, IE. no need to change it again for standard when these go to wild, so I assume the function is here to stay.
They should honestly make Invoke cards act like any other normal card, I don't get why they do this.
They didn't do this with the C'thun cards either and no one complained.
There are highrolls in RNG, and lowrolls, and if you get a Galakrond card in a non-Galakrond deck, well that's a lowroll but aside from the 4 Mana 2/2 Rush, nothing would even be that terrible.
C'thun cards differed in that they mostly provided around vanilla value even when disregarding the C'thun buff. Invoke cards (2-mana freeze a character, 5 mana 4/5 taunt, 4 mana 2/2 rush, 1 mana give a minion +1 attack etc.) are almost unplayable without the invoke effect.
